      <description>Cross the 300-meter wooden footbridge to Trakai Island Castle before ten in the morning and the red-brick ramparts are still quiet enough to hear the lake lapping against the barbican walls. That gap before the tour buses arrive from Vilnius is the single best planning tip for anyone building a day around Trakai&amp;rsquo;s activities.
The Island Castle and its museum The Gothic water fortress on Castle Island is the reason most visitors come, and it earns the trip: eleven exhibition halls inside the ducal palace hold Grand Duchy weaponry, coin hoards and armor, plus views over Lake Galvė from the wooden gallery ramparts.</description>
